The interdisciplinary field that studies the ways in which culture creates and transforms individual experiences, social relations, and power is known as cultural studies. It focuses on cultural analysis which concentrates on the political aspects of contemporary culture, traits, conflicts, historical foundation and contingencies. Cultural studies encompasses a range of methodological and theoretical perspectives and practices. The objectives of this domain include understanding culture in all its diverse and complex forms, and to analyze the political and social context in which culture displays itself. The exchanges and flows that occur across national borders fall under the umbrella of transnationalism. Transnational cultural studies is an area of enquiry, which can help in understanding the differences in global culture and develop a critique of globalization.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
